Scripture:
Isaiah 9:7 -
"Of the increase of his government and peace there will be no end..."
Reflection:
Jesus is not just a figure to admire; He is the King we are called to obey. Reflect on whether Jesus truly reigns as King in your heart. Are there areas where you are still trying to share the throne with Him? Consider how His reign can bring transformation and renewal to your life, as you submit to His authority and follow His lead.
Prayer:
King Jesus, I surrender my heart to You. I confess that I often try to share the throne with You, seeking my own way instead of submitting to Your authority. Take Your rightful place on the throne of my life. Help me to follow You wholeheartedly and to trust in Your perfect rule over my life. Amen.
Action:
Take a moment to evaluate your heart. Identify any areas where you have not fully surrendered to Jesus. Write a prayer of surrender, asking Him to take control and reign as King in those areas. Consider sharing your prayer with a trusted friend or mentor, asking them to pray with you and hold you accountable in your journey of faith.
